Daughter wants to be a doctor when she grows up, so Mom transforms playroom into stunning medical office

It’s not uncommon for kids to make-believe they have different jobs. The imaginative mental exercise can help them figure out their likes and dislikes while having fun.

When Josie Robinson learned her daughter Journey wanted to be a doctor someday, the mom took things to the next level. Robinson transformed her daughter’s entire bedroom into quite the elaborate doctor’s office.

“My daughter says that she wants to be a doctor when she grows up,” Robinson explained. “I was like, ‘Dude, you can be a doctor right now.'”

The mom turned Journey’s room into a pretty convincing doctor’s office. There was a receptionist area that included a desk with a patient sign-in list, laptop, phone and even hand sanitizer.

“Her laptop and phone don’t work. They’re just for pretend purposes,” the mom said.

Robinson organized a shelf with files, fake patient forms, clipboards and other supplies you’d expect to see. There was a scale, set of crutches and X-ray printouts on the walls. The mom even got her daughter an exam room where patients could get their physicals, as well as an optometry area and waiting room. But that didn’t include the medical supplies.

“Cotton swabs, diaper rash cream, happy pills which are candy, Band-Aids, ice packs,” Robinson said.

Journey even had a fake diploma to certify that she was in fact a real pretend doctor. People were endeared by the detailed fantasy Robinson created for her daughter, and the video racked up 1.3 million likes.

“I’m a senior med student and I want this,” one person wrote.

“When she becomes a doctor, this will be great to look at, and keep in mind, mom and dad were always supportive,” another said.

“I’m a nurse and think this is a better doc office than any I have ever seen,” a user commented.
